It is the similar with navigation. Real, modern navigation works in on-line mode, using latest data stored on an Internet server.
NaviExpert works based on precise map of Poland that is continuously verified and updated, so the users are always provided with latest versions of the maps.
As soon as the destination point is chosen, maps (with indications for designated route) are downloaded from the NaviExpert server. Maps are optimized, so that the downloaded data portions are as small as possible, which guarantees cost optimization for such navigation.

a) Radio signals from many satellites (1) are sent to GPS module (2) for precise determination of coordinates.
GPS determines the receiver location with high precision (up to a few meters), which enables the system to guide the user along the route and to inform about any direction change.
b) GPS module (2) communicated by means of wireless Bluetooth and cable connection with a mobile phone with NaviExpert application installed (3).
A handy phone does not disturb the driver - its size does not impede car driving. The GPS module can be put near the windscreen, at the dashboard or even in the glove box.
c) NaviExpert application in mobile phone (3) connects with NaviExpert server (4) using the economical GPRS data transmission protocol. According to the wish of the driver, who indicates the destination point, the application downloads proper map from NaviExpert server and begins navigation, informing about maneuvers and warning about obstructions and photoradars.
The NaviExpert system user is always provided with newest maps, which means that information about road conditions may have been updated just a few minutes earlier.

NaviExpert does not only guides precisely to the destination, but also proposes fastest route based on statistics of thousands of passings of real drivers.
NaviExpert guides along the route that passes round sections with roadworks and even temporary traffic jams. The route depends on hour of the day (it is different in rush hours and different at night), weather and road conditions.
NaviExpert is the system created by drivers' community, who warn one another about road obstructions, dangers and who add information on new photoradars and by-passes to the existing map.
